"The use of nanoparticles in industrial, medicine and many other application has provoked their release to the environment. This book gives response to the main questions related to their occurrence in the environment, their impact on biota in aquatic systems, application of new methodologies and changes associated to new global scenarios"-- Cover; Title Page; Copyright Page; Preface; Acknowledgements; Table of Contents; 1: Toxicity of Metal and Metal Oxide Engineered Nanoparticles to Phytoplankton; 2: Sublethal Effects of Nanoparticles on Aquatic Invertebrates, from Molecular to Organism Level; 3: In Vitro Testing: In Vitro Toxicity Testing with Bivalve Mollusc and Fish Cells for the Risk Assessment of Nanoparticles in the Aquatic Environment; 4: Toxicity Tests and Bioassays for Aquatic Ecotoxicology of Engineered Nanomaterials; 5: Nanomaterial Transport and Ecotoxicity in Fish Embryos 6: Effects of Nanomaterials on the Body Systems of Fishes-An Overview from Target Organ Pathology7: Nanoparticles Under the Spotlight: Intracellular Fate and Toxic Effects on Cells of Aquatic Organisms as Revealed by Microscopy; 8: Insights from 'Omics on the Exposure and Effects of Engineered Nanomaterials on Aquatic Organisms; 9: Nanomaterials in Aquatic Sediments; 10: The Role of Ecotoxicology in the Eco-Design of Nanomaterials for Water Remediation; 11: Analytical Tools Able to Detect ENP/NM/MNs in both Artificial and Natural Environmental Water Media; Index
